Output 706ae33c188dde20e86821201d24ddf8ca95ce360084a901015805f2590a3262:51

value
4389643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ba6dc4fef09c9e1fecc359df56c02cfdf40d8cc OP_EQUAL
address
3QddRNSpCPo6RRekv7hs7JtLQLhR8ybmkY
transaction
706ae33c188dde20e86821201d24ddf8ca95ce360084a901015805f2590a3262
spent
true